本文关于数据库及电子商务系统及智能计算机方面的免费优秀学术论文范文,数据库方面论文范文参考文献,与基于SpringMVC的数据库分页查询技术应用相关专升本毕业论文范文,对不知道怎么写数据库论文范文课题研究的大学硕士、本科毕业论文开题报告范文和文献综述及职称论文的作为参考文献资料下载。
摘 要 :在电子商务系统中,由于用户查询条件的宽泛性,可能会出现大量符合条件的查询结果.为了快速响应用户查询,在数据库设计和访问过程中,除了建立合理的索引机制以外,必须对查询结果进行分页处理.在传统Spring MVC框架基础上,增加了Bo层,其主要作用为参数封装,并从数据库的生成、业务逻辑的配置、Dao层、Service层、Controller层、Bo层、Jsp层等多个层次优化数据访问过程.通过实验分析,对比传统分页方法,在平均响应时间上具有明显优势,且依托良好的层次结构,具有可移植性强的优点.
关 键 词 :电商系统; Spring框架; MVC; 数据库设计; 分页显示
中图分类号:TP393 文献标识码:A文章编号:2095-2163(2014)04-0009-05
Abstract:In current e-merce systems, due to the broadness of user query, database queries often get a large number of eligible query results. For the purpose of quickly respond to user queries, during the process of database design and access, in addition to a reasonable indexing mechanism, the query results display must be paged display. With improved Spring MVC framework, the Bo-layer is added between JSP-layer and Controller-layer, whose main role is as a parameter package. Also, from database generating, business logic configuration, Dao-layer design, Service-layer design, Controller-layer design, Bo-layer design, Jsp-layer design and so on, the paper optimizes data access process. After that , through experimental analysis, pared with traditional paging method, this method has obvious advantages in the aspects such as average response time, a clear frame hierarchy and good portability.
这篇论文网址:http://www.sxsky.net/shangwu/394319.html
Key words:E-merce System; Spring Framework; MVC; Database Design; Pagination Display
0引言
随着电子商务系统规模的增加,涉及访问的数据量可能会达到上万甚至是百万条,为保证用户浏览数据的体验效果、提升Web服务器的响应速度并减轻服务器的通信负载,就必须对查询数据进行分页显示.
在国内外的应用研究中,已提出了有关分页显示的多种方案,常见的方法有SQL分页算法、JSP分页方法、使用标签库、将查询结果缓存在HttpSession或变量中实现分页等,但在实际应用中却都存在一定的不足和缺陷.具体分析如下.
(1)直接利用数据库管理系统提供的分页功能来实现数据分页.该方法虽然可以提高性能,但不同数据库实现的方法各不相同,因而对于不同的项目缺乏通用性.
(2)将查询结果缓存在HttpSession或变量中实现分页.此方法虽然可以减少数据库的连接次数,但却会占用大量Web容器内存[1],而且会导致用户查看到的可能是过期数据.
(3)直接在数据库上建立游标,使用ResultSet移动游标实现分页,使游标定位结果集.这种方式在操作大型数据和访问用户众多的时候,却可能导致DBMS因为资源耗尽而崩溃[2].
有关论文范文主题研究: | 数据库相关论文范文 | 大学生适用: | 函授论文、函授毕业论文 |
---|---|---|---|
相关参考文献下载数量: | 70 | 写作解决问题: | 本科论文怎么写 |
毕业论文开题报告: | 标准论文格式、论文前言 | 职称论文适用: | 杂志投稿、职称评中级 |
所属大学生专业类别: | 本科论文怎么写 | 论文题目推荐度: | 最新题目 |
2基于Spring MVC分页方案
5结束语
本文针对电子商务系统中,用户查询条件宽泛导致出现大量符合条件的查询结果的问题,提出了利用改进的Spring MVC框架实现分页的方法.首先,利用Spring MVC框架,实现了表示层、业务层和逻辑层的分离;其次,在传统框架基础上做出改进,加入Bo层,对数据进行封装,缩短数据传输时间.本文的测试分析结果显示,该方法具有响应时间短、移植性高的优点.
但本文提出的方法也存在不足,当商品输入为海量数据时,其响应时间就会较长,下一步将针对此现象作出改进.其后的工作重点还包括将提出的分页技术实现相应的模块化,可以被不同项
数据库方面论文范文参考文献
参考文献:
[1]何玲娟,蚁 龙,刘连臣. 一种松耦合高复用 MVC 模式的 Web 分页实现[J]. 计算机工程与应用,2007,43( 15) : 95 -97.
[2]崔行臣,张明光. 一种基于Struts框架的Web分页模型的设计与实现[J]. 山东科学, 2013, 26(4):60-64.
[3]丁振凡. 利用Spring MVC实现数据分页显示处理[J]. 智能计算机与应用. 2012,2(5):20-22.
[4]陈雄华, 林开雄. Spring 3.x 企业级应用开发实战[M]. 北京:电子工业出版社, 2013.
[5]Naveen Balani, Spring系列:Spring框架简介. [EB/OL]. http://.ibm./developerworks//java/wa-spring1/, 2005-08-18.
[6]丁振凡, 李馨梅. 基于JdbcTemplate的数据库访问处理[J]. 智能计算机与应用,2012,2(3):29-32.
[7]勾成图,张,李军怀. 海量数据分页机制在Web信息系统中的应用研究[J]. 计算机应用,2005,25(8):1926-1929.
数据库方面求电子商务论文,关于基于SpringMVC的数据库分页查询技术应用相关自考毕业论文开题报告参考文献:
基于web特色数据库文检索系统的研发
[摘 要]依据特色数据库建设理论,使用asp、md5加密等技术,使用sqlserver部署特色数据库论文检索系统并在建设有高职特色的学院论文数据库系。
万方数据库论文查询
业技术水平,能力,业绩的代表性成果奖励(专利)证明和其他代表性着作,论文,作品等证明复印件1份,同时提供网络查询信息复印件1份.(论文,着作复印件只提供封面,目录及本人论。万方数据。
计算机应用技术培训
数据库应用技术高等职业院校,专业骨干教师培训方案,培训机构名称:平顶山工业职业技术学院,培训专业类别:计算机应用技术(网络方向),联系人:王德永,联系电话。计算机科学与技术专业简。
电子技术应用期刊
作系统应用,电子技术基础,程序设计基础,微型计算机组装与维护,计算机网络应用基础,计算机办公自动化,多媒体及常用软件应。数据库应用技术高等职业院校,专业骨干教师培训方案,培训机构名称。
计算机应用电子技术
公自动化,多媒体及常用软件应。多媒体技术应用,信息技术高一下社数据库技术数据库系统概论(第四版)王珊高等教育出版社网络应用技术计算机网络技术与应用解文彬电子工业出版社毛,邓,三…。
计算机网络应用技术
型计算机及接口技术00022高等数学(工。多媒体技术应用,信息技术高一下社数据库技术数据库系统概论(第四版)王珊高等教育出版社网络应用技术计算机网络技术与应用解文彬电子工业出版社。
计算机应用技术论文
计算机应用技术论文题目广东别,排名等不符合要求的科技成果和科研课题,建议不要提交.,(四)论文,着作材料,论文,着作必须是取得现专业技术资格以来至工作资历计算截止时间(2016年。
计算机技术应用论文
计算机应用技术论文题目广东别,排名等不符合要求的科技成果和科研课题,建议不要提交.,(四)论文,着作材料,论文,着作必须是取得现专业技术资格以来至工作资历计算截止时间(2016年。
计算机应用技术 论文
计算机应用技术论文题目广东别,排名等不符合要求的科技成果和科研课题,建议不要提交.,(四)论文,着作材料,论文,着作必须是取得现专业技术资格以来至工作资历计算截止时间(2016年。
计算机应用技术
后,方可向评审机构提交一级资质申报材料.,2,计算机信息系统集成是指从事计算机应用系统工程和网络系。数据库应用技术高等职业院校,专业骨干教师培训方案,培训机构名称:平顶山工业职业技。